Gregorian in Japan

Gregorian perfomed in Japan for the first time ever on the 6th of September!

 

Gregorian, brainchild of acclaimed music producer Frank Peterson (Nemo Studios, Hamburg, Germany)  appeared at the historic Toshodaiji Temple in Naga, following an invitation from a Japanese television station. An estimated 30 million viewers will be watching the Japanese TV station MBS on November 3rd to see and hear the performance by the group.

 

Gregorian perfomed three selections from the upcoming release, Masters of Chant VII, along with their immortal and beloved song, Moment of Peace.  Included from the new album were songs Sweet Child of Mine, Arrival and It Will Be Forgiven.

 

The exact time of the performance is unknown at this point. An announcement will be made as soon as details are known!
